Instructions

Step 1
Heat a drizzle of oil in a frying pan on high heat.
Once hot, fry the mince and mushrooms, 5-6 mins. Break up the mince as it cooks.
Once cooked, drain the fat from the mince. Season with salt and pepper.

Step 2
Next, add the sliced carrot and cabbage mix. Stir-fry, 1-2 mins.
Add the udon to the pan. Toss to coat, using a fork to gently separate them.
Stir-fry, 1 min more.

Step 3
Stir in the teriyaki, sambal, soy, honey and water. TIP: Put hardened honey into hot water for 1 min.
Toss to coat everything in the sauce.
Stir-fry, 1 min more.
Taste and season with salt and pepper if needed.

Step 4
Share the noodles between your serving bowls.
Sprinkle over the peanuts to finish.
